Performance Engines for Sports Cars
Performance engines for sports cars and trucks are specifically crafted to supply boosted agility, rate, and power, establishing them aside from typical automotive engines. These engines often make use of advanced innovations such as turbocharging, supercharging, and variable valve timing to make best use of effectiveness and responsiveness.
Usually, performance engines are created with higher compression proportions, which enable greater power extraction from fuel. This leads to impressive horse power and torque numbers, allowing rapid acceleration and greater leading rates. Furthermore, the light-weight materials used in these engines, such as aluminum and carbon fiber, add to lowered general vehicle weight, boosting handling and ability to move.
Engine setups like V6, V8, and even hybrid systems prevail in efficiency cars, each offering special benefits in terms of power delivery and driving dynamics. The tuning of these engines is additionally vital; numerous manufacturers maximize the engine management systems to supply an exciting driving experience, frequently including sport settings that adjust throttle reaction and equipment shifts.
Reliable Engines for Daily Commuters
In the realm of everyday commuting, efficient engines play a critical role in maximizing fuel economic climate and reducing emissions while supplying reputable efficiency. As city populations grow and environmental concerns intensify, the need for cars furnished with efficient powertrains has surged.
Modern engines made for daily commuters commonly include technologies such as turbocharging, direct gas shot, and crossbreed systems. Turbocharging boosts engine efficiency by requiring more air into the combustion chamber, permitting smaller, lighter engines that do not jeopardize power outcome. Straight fuel shot enhances gas atomization, bring about better burning and boosted performance.
Crossbreed engines, combining internal combustion with electrical power, more boost gas economic situation, particularly in stop-and-go website traffic, where traditional engines can experience inadequacies. Electric electric motors aid throughout acceleration and can run separately at low speeds, minimizing total gas intake.
Moreover, advancements in engine administration systems and lightweight products add dramatically to effective engine style. Heavy-Duty Engines for Work Autos
Sturdy engines for work vehicles are consistently engineered to deliver extraordinary torque and reliability under requiring conditions. These engines are developed to execute in environments where traditional engines might fail, such as building and construction sites, logging procedures, and agricultural setups. Usually, heavy-duty engines use advanced products and robust construction methods to withstand the roughness of hefty workloads. Functions such as enhanced cylinder blocks, boosted cooling systems, and progressed fuel injection modern technologies add to their effectiveness. These engines commonly run at lower RPMs, which aids to enhance gas efficiency while offering the needed power for hauling and carrying.
Along with mechanical robustness, sturdy engines are frequently furnished with innovative digital control units (ECUs) that take care of performance, discharges, and diagnostics. This assimilation enables much better monitoring and maintenance, making certain that job vehicles stay reliable and functional.
